Show patches with: Submitter = Jan Beulich       |    Archived = No       |   442 patches
« 1 2 3 44 5 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[3/4] x86-64: improve gas diagnostic when no 32-bit target is configured x86: (mostly) testsuite adjustments - - - -1- 2023-05-19 Jan Beulich Unresolved
[2/4] x86-64: conditionalize tests using --32 x86: (mostly) testsuite adjustments - - - -1- 2023-05-19 Jan Beulich Unresolved
[1/4] x86: split gas testsuite .exp file x86: (mostly) testsuite adjustments - - - -1- 2023-05-19 Jan Beulich Unresolved
[2/2] x86: figure braces aren't really part of mnemonics x86: lexical meaning of characters - - - -1- 2023-05-19 Jan Beulich Unresolved
[1/2] x86: de-duplicate operand_special_chars[] wrt extra_symbol_chars[] x86: lexical meaning of characters - - - -1- 2023-05-19 Jan Beulich Unresolved
ld: drop stray blank from ld.texi ld: drop stray blank from ld.texi - - - -1- 2023-05-19 Jan Beulich Unresolved
x86: permit all relational operators in insn operands x86: permit all relational operators in insn operands - - - 1-- 2023-05-17 Jan Beulich Accepted
[4/4] x86: further adjust extend-to-32bit-address conditions improve range checking for certain constants on x86 - - - -1- 2023-05-05 Jan Beulich Unresolved
[3/4] gas: invoke md_optimize_expr() also for unary expressions improve range checking for certain constants on x86 - - - -1- 2023-05-05 Jan Beulich Unresolved
[2/4] gas: maintain O_constant signedness in more cases improve range checking for certain constants on x86 - - - -1- 2023-05-05 Jan Beulich Unresolved
[1/4] x86: tighten extend-to-32bit-address conditions improve range checking for certain constants on x86 - - - 1-- 2023-05-05 Jan Beulich Accepted
[2/2] x86/Intel: address quoted-symbol related FIXMEs x86: don't recognize quoted symbol names as registers or operators - - - 1-- 2023-05-05 Jan Beulich Accepted
[1/2] x86: don't recognize quoted symbol names as registers or operators x86: don't recognize quoted symbol names as registers or operators - - - 1-- 2023-05-05 Jan Beulich Accepted
[2/2] x86: move a few more disassembler helper functions x86: move a few disassembler helper functions - - - -1- 2023-05-05 Jan Beulich Unresolved
[1/2] x86: move get<N>() disassembler helper functions x86: move a few disassembler helper functions - - - -1- 2023-05-05 Jan Beulich Unresolved
x86: slightly simplify i386_parse_name() x86: slightly simplify i386_parse_name() - - - 1-- 2023-05-05 Jan Beulich Accepted
[v2] gas: equates of registers [v2] gas: equates of registers - - - -1- 2023-05-02 Jan Beulich Unresolved
RISC-V: tighten post-relocation-operator separator expectation RISC-V: tighten post-relocation-operator separator expectation - - - -1- 2023-04-28 Jan Beulich Unresolved
x86/Intel: reduce ELF/PE conditional scope in x86_cons() x86/Intel: reduce ELF/PE conditional scope in x86_cons() - - - 1-- 2023-04-26 Jan Beulich Accepted
[3/3] x86: limit data passed to i386_dis_printf() x86: further disassembler tweaks - - - -1- 2023-04-24 Jan Beulich Unresolved
[2/3] x86: limit data passed to prefix_name() x86: further disassembler tweaks - - - -1- 2023-04-24 Jan Beulich Unresolved
[1/3] x86: work around compiler diagnosing dangling pointer x86: further disassembler tweaks - - - -1- 2023-04-24 Jan Beulich Unresolved
gas: equates of registers gas: equates of registers - - - -1- 2023-04-21 Jan Beulich Unresolved
gas: move shift count check gas: move shift count check - - - 1-- 2023-04-21 Jan Beulich Accepted
[2/2] x86: rework AMX control insn disassembly x86: rework AMX insn disassembly - - - -1- 2023-04-21 Jan Beulich Unresolved
[1/2] x86: rework AMX multiplication insn disassembly x86: rework AMX insn disassembly - - - -1- 2023-04-21 Jan Beulich Unresolved
bfd: fix STRICT_PE_FORMAT build bfd: fix STRICT_PE_FORMAT build - - - 1-- 2023-04-21 Jan Beulich Accepted
ld: add missing period after @xref ld: add missing period after @xref - - - 1-- 2023-04-21 Jan Beulich Accepted
[8/8] x86: drop (explicit) BFD64 dependency from disassembler x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
[7/8] x86: drop use of setjmp() from disassembler x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
[6/8] x86: change fetch error handling for get<N>() x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
[5/8] x86: change fetch error handling when processing operands x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
[4/8] x86: change fetch error handling in get_valid_dis386() x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
[3/8] x86: change fetch error handling in ckprefix() x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
[2/8] x86: change fetch error handling in top-level function x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
[1/8] x86: move fetch error handling into a helper function x86: do away with (ab)using setjmp/longjmp for error handling - - - 1-- 2023-04-04 Jan Beulich Accepted
bfd+ld: when / whether to generate .c files bfd+ld: when / whether to generate .c files - - - 1-- 2023-03-31 Jan Beulich Accepted
[3/3] gas: document that get_symbol_name() can clobber the input buffer better fix for PR gas/30248 - - - -1- 2023-03-31 Jan Beulich Unresolved
[2/3] x86: parse_register() must not alter the parsed string better fix for PR gas/30248 - - - -1- 2023-03-31 Jan Beulich Unresolved
[1/3] x86: parse_real_register() does not alter the parsed string better fix for PR gas/30248 - - - 1-- 2023-03-31 Jan Beulich Accepted
Arm64/ELF: accept relocations against STN_UNDEF Arm64/ELF: accept relocations against STN_UNDEF - - - 1-- 2023-03-23 Jan Beulich Accepted
[RFC,v2,14/14] x86: .insn example - VEX-encoded instructions of original Xeon Phi x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,13/14] x86: convert testcases to use .insn x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,12/14] x86: document .insn x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,11/14] x86: handle immediate operands for .insn x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,10/14] x86: allow for multiple immediates in output_disp() x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,09/14] x86: handle EVEX Disp8 for .insn x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,08/14] x86: process instruction operands for .insn x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,07/14] x86/AT&T: restrict recognition of the "absolute branch" prefix character x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,06/14] x86: drop "shimm" special case template expansions x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,05/14] x86: VexVVVV is now merely a boolean x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,04/14] x86: re-work build_modrm_byte()'s register assignment x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,03/14] x86: parse special opcode modifiers for .insn x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,02/14] x86: parse VEX and alike specifiers for .insn x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,01/14] x86: introduce .insn directive x86: new .insn directive - - - 1-- 2023-03-10 Jan Beulich Accepted
x86: drop identifier_chars[] x86: drop identifier_chars[] - - - 1-- 2023-03-10 Jan Beulich Accepted
gas: apply md_register_arithmetic also to unary '+' gas: apply md_register_arithmetic also to unary '+' - - - 1-- 2023-03-10 Jan Beulich Accepted
[RFC] RISC-V: alter the special character used in FAKE_LABEL_NAME [RFC] RISC-V: alter the special character used in FAKE_LABEL_NAME -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,7/7] RISC-V: adjust logic to avoid register name symbols RISC-V/gas: insn operand parsing -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,6/7] RISC-V: test for expected / no unexpected symbols RISC-V/gas: insn operand parsing -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,5/7] RISC-V: relax post-relocation-operator separator expectation RISC-V/gas: insn operand parsing -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,4/7] RISC-V: don't recognize bogus relocations RISC-V/gas: insn operand parsing -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,3/7] RISC-V: avoid redundant and misleading/wrong error messages RISC-V/gas: insn operand parsing -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,2/7] RISC-V: drop "percent_op" parameter from my_getOpcodeExpression() RISC-V/gas: insn operand parsing - - - 1-- 2023-03-10 Jan Beulich Accepted
[v2,1/7] RISC-V: minor effort reduction in relocation specifier parsing RISC-V/gas: insn operand parsing - - - 1-- 2023-03-10 Jan Beulich Accepted
[4/4] gas: expose flag_macro_alternate globally gas: tidy macro interfacing after removal of gasp - - - 1-- 2023-03-08 Jan Beulich Accepted
[3/4] gas: use flag_mri directly in macro processing gas: tidy macro interfacing after removal of gasp - - - 1-- 2023-03-08 Jan Beulich Accepted
[2/4] gas: isolate macro_strip_at to macro.c gas: tidy macro interfacing after removal of gasp - - - 1-- 2023-03-08 Jan Beulich Accepted
[1/4] gas: drop function pointer parameter from macro_init() gas: tidy macro interfacing after removal of gasp - - - 1-- 2023-03-08 Jan Beulich Accepted
[RFC,18/18] x86: .insn example - VEX-encoded instructions of original Xeon Phi x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[17/18] x86: convert testcases to use .insn x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[16/18] x86: document .insn x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[15/18] x86: handle immediate operands for .insn x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[14/18] x86: allow for multiple immediates in output_disp() x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[13/18] x86: handle EVEX Disp8 for .insn x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[12/18] x86: decouple broadcast type and bytes fields x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[11/18] x86: process instruction operands for .insn x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[10/18] x86/AT&T: restrict recognition of the "absolute branch" prefix character x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[09/18] x86: drop "shimm" special case template expansions x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[08/18] x86: VexVVVV is now merely a boolean x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[07/18] x86: re-work build_modrm_byte()'s register assignment x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[06/18] x86-64: adjust REX-prefix part of SSE2AVX test x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[05/18] x86: move more disp processing out of md_assemble() x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[04/18] x86: use set_rex_vrex() also for short-form handling x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[03/18] x86: parse special opcode modifiers for .insn x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[02/18] x86: parse VEX and alike specifiers for .insn x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[01/18] x86: introduce .insn directive x86: new .insn directive - - - 1-- 2023-03-03 Jan Beulich Accepted
[2/2] x86: use swap_2_operands() in build_vex_prefix() x86: assorted small tidies - - - -1- 2023-02-24 Jan Beulich Unresolved
[1/2] x86: drop redundant calculation of EVEX broadcast size x86: assorted small tidies - - - -1- 2023-02-24 Jan Beulich Unresolved
gas: default .debug section compression method adjustments gas: default .debug section compression method adjustments - - - -1- 2023-02-24 Jan Beulich Unresolved
x86: avoid .byte in testcases where possible x86: avoid .byte in testcases where possible - - - -1- 2023-02-22 Jan Beulich Unresolved
RISC-V: as_warn() already emits a newline RISC-V: as_warn() already emits a newline - - - -1- 2023-02-16 Jan Beulich Unresolved
x86/gas: replace inappropriate assertion when parsing registers x86/gas: replace inappropriate assertion when parsing registers - - - 1-- 2023-02-15 Jan Beulich Accepted
gas: buffer_and_nest() needs to pass nul-terminated string to temp_ilp() gas: buffer_and_nest() needs to pass nul-terminated string to temp_ilp() - - - 1-- 2023-02-14 Jan Beulich Accepted
gas: correct symbol name comparison in .startof./.sizeof. handling gas: correct symbol name comparison in .startof./.sizeof. handling - - - 1-- 2023-02-13 Jan Beulich Accepted
x86: {LD,ST}TILECFG use an extension opcode x86: {LD,ST}TILECFG use an extension opcode - - - 1-- 2023-02-13 Jan Beulich Accepted
gas: improve interaction between read_a_source_file() and s_linefile() gas: improve interaction between read_a_source_file() and s_linefile() - - - 1-- 2023-02-13 Jan Beulich Accepted
[2/2] Arm64/gas: drop redundant feature prereqs Arm64/gas: adjustments to features' prereqs - - - 1-- 2023-02-13 Jan Beulich Accepted
[1/2] Arm64/gas: add missing prereq features Arm64/gas: adjustments to features' prereqs - - - 1-- 2023-02-13 Jan Beulich Accepted
[2/2] RISC-V: adjust logic to avoid register name symbols RISC-V/gas: re-work register named symbols avoidance logic - - - 1-- 2023-02-13 Jan Beulich Accepted
« 1 2 3 44 5 »